High End Treadmills

The top treadmills are designed for athletes who are serious and come with various features that will meet your fitness goals. They usually have larger motors and sturdy frames that can withstand the abuse runners can inflict on treadmills. They also have more advanced technology with interactive programming and a more efficient exercise experience. They can be more expensive than cheaper treadmills, but they last longer.

Most top treadmills come with an array of pre-programmed exercises for weight loss, endurance for the heart, and speed training. These workouts will automatically alter the speed and the incline of the treadmill to match the parameters of the specific program you're using. These workouts are perfect for those who want to follow a program led by a trainer, but don't need to manually alter the treadmill's settings while running.

Certain high-end treadmills were created for commercial use. They have industrial-grade parts, like the flywheel that weighs 10 pounds. This minimizes noise and vibration. These treadmills can usually accommodate several users and are great for running clubs or smaller studio gyms. Some have features such as the capability to charge devices or run with music streaming apps (often requiring subscriptions).

Other essential aspects to look for in a high-end treadmill are the highest speed and amount of incline and decline that it can provide. Ideally, you'll want to find a treadmill that can run speeds of up to 12 mph speed and replicate hilly terrain with a maximum incline of 15 percent or downhill training with the maximum drop of 33%..

In the end, you'll want to make sure that any treadmill of the highest quality you choose has plenty of warranty protection. Most treadmills will have a lifetime frame warranty as well as motor warranty, as well with 3-7 years of parts protection. This is a lot superior to what you find on cheap treadmills which only offer a year's warranty protection.

Commercial Treadmills

The top commercial treadmills are made to withstand the weight of a gym stuffed with runners or a family filled with marathon runners. They're made from stronger materials, have stronger frames and belts which can support 300 pounds or more, and typically have powerful motors that resist overheating in the case of heavy use. They also have more special features, such as decline and incline options, or integrated fitness apps that provide trainer-led endurance exercise routines, HIIT and Tabata.

They tend to be more expensive due to this. A quality commercial treadmill comes with a guarantee that covers the frame for at least 15 years and parts and electronics for five years. The Sole TT8 has a durable frame that can support up to 400 pounds. It also features wheels that can be reversible and crowned to help reduce wear and tear of the belt. The TT8 two-ply is sprayed with paraffin wax which can last for up to 20,000 kilometers and be reapplied if needed.

The NordicTrack Commercial X32i, which is one of our top-rated commercial treadmills has some impressive running metrics. For instance, it comes with an incline of 40 percent that puts your quads and glutes to the test. It also has handrails that can be adjusted that are made for training on incline. Its 4.25 CHP motor can reach speeds of up to 12 mph. The running deck is a bit larger than the standard 20"x55" found on most treadmills.

These treadmills are heavier and more durable than your typical home treadmill. They also aren't foldable to store them. Therefore, you'll need to ensure you have a place in your home or gym which is free of other equipment like barbells, dumbbells and yoga mats. You should also consider whether you want it to take up a lot of floor space or if you'd like to put it on the wall to save space.

Folding Treadmills

The positive side is that a treadmill doesn't have to be bulky and permanent placed in your home. Folding treadmills take up less space and can be an ideal option for those who live in smaller homes or apartments and wish to be able to incorporate an exercise program that is not too strenuous to their daily routines. Many folding treadmills are easy to fold and use.

In terms of how efficient the folding treadmill is, the answer is dependent on the type of workout you prefer to do Joye says. Joye. Some treadmills that fold down into compact, slim packages are ideal for walking or slow running but not suitable for running. Some, like this model from Sunny Health & Fitness, are built for runners and feature an incline high enough to be challenging for even the most serious runners. It also includes 30 pre-programmed workouts, Bluetooth connectivity, and more.

Another thing to think about is whether a treadmill has the speed range you need. Some models are small and sleek, and can only run up to three miles per hour. This is a walking speed, not the ideal speed for running. But other folding treadmills are equipped with stronger motors that can handle an entire jog, such as this one from Sole Fitness.

The deck's size is crucial, as a bigger deck is more comfortable for the majority of runners.

Find a treadmill that has safety features. It should come with an emergency stop clip that can be used to stop the belt in case you fall or trip. It's worth paying extra to get a model with this feature, since it can mean the difference between being injured and being able to continue your workout.
